Hello,I`ve a bait boat(D.A.M. - D-Fender) that works on 6V,but he motor stopped working and I`m looking for something appropriate with the same size and specifications to change it.There is nothing written on the motor.

Dimensions of the motor:
Diameter:62.2mm
Length: 67mm
Diameter of shaft: 5mm
Free shaft 10-14 mm
Amperage idle 2A
Battery:7AH 6V

I`ve open it and saw that there is no  cooling on the rotor and brushes.
Can I change it with this motor  8.4v (Graupner Speed 700BB Turbo 8.4V ) or something better and where I can buy it?
Technical specifications of the boat:
Dimensions: 55 x 27 x 28 cm 6kg
6V DC
It was moving with 7km/h I`d like to move with around 10km/h with the new motor

The 720 Torque is an excellent motor but too slow on your 6v supply, whereas the Speed 700BB 8.4v is probably too fast. We now have stocks of a new 5-pole general purpose 755 motor which will turn @ about 3500RPM (no load) on 6v and do the job well. PM me for details if you like.
